Saturday 11 October


What a beautiful morning!! Certainly a good morning to watch the horses. It was not the busiest of mornings, as there are one or two on the easy list for another few days, and quite a few had run in the last week or so. First lot saw Troglodyte,Ogee,and College Ace all have a walk and trot about, they also did one steady canter just to stretch their legs.After breakfast a few owners both new and old pitched up. Ben Turner along with his Father, Brother and Uncle came to see Bobby Gee and finalise his quarter share, Bob Graham came in to see Kikos and Rousing Rob, and Don McGeachy showed up later on just to walk round and have a look at things. Everyone chose a really good morning to come - the weather was fantastic, although Ben did get a little chilly on top of the hill (he needs to wait for January)!! Kikos worked with Important Business second lot, and both were very very good. Kikos will not be declared for Huntingdon on Tuesday as the ground is good to firm, instead he will wait for Uttoxeter at the end of the month, and Important Business will head to Aintree on Satuday or Sunday the 25th or 26th of October. Mattaking is fine after Towcester and will have an entry at Plumpton a week on Monday. Bobby Gee will resume fitness work in about 10 days, as he is showing no ill effects of his muscle tear last week. All in all a very good morning, and a real pleasure to be watching the horses and making a few plans.
